Definition and Production Process

Lyocell fabric is made from wood pulp cellulose and produced using a solvent spinning process. This method involves dissolving the wood pulp in a solvent, typically N-methylmorpholine N-oxide (NMMO), to create a uniform solution. The solution is then extruded through a spinneret, creating fibers that are collected and washed with water to remove any remaining solvent.

The raw materials used for lyocell production can vary depending on the manufacturer’s choice, but wood pulp from sustainable sources such as birch or eucalyptus trees is commonly used. Some manufacturers also use bamboo or other plant-based materials. The key characteristic of these raw materials is their high cellulose content, which makes them ideal for producing lyocell fibers.

The solvent spinning process allows for the creation of strong and lightweight fibers that can be blended with other natural fibers to enhance their performance. However, it’s worth noting that some manufacturers may still use small amounts of chemicals in the production process, so it’s essential to look for certifications such as Oeko-Tex or GOTS when shopping for eco-friendly lyocell products.

Improved Comfort and Performance for End-Users

When it comes to eco-friendly lyocell fabrics, one of the most significant advantages is the enhanced comfort and performance they offer end-users. Let’s dive into some of the key benefits.

Lyocell fabrics are renowned for their exceptional moisture-wicking properties, which enable them to draw sweat away from the skin and release it quickly. This makes them an ideal choice for activewear and outdoor clothing, where moisture buildup can lead to discomfort and chafing. To put this into perspective, a study found that lyocell fabrics can wick up to 10% more moisture than cotton-based materials.

The breathability of lyocell fabrics is another significant advantage, allowing air to circulate freely and preventing the buildup of heat and humidity. This results in improved wearer comfort, particularly during high-intensity activities or in warm environments. Additionally, lyocell’s unique texture provides a softness that rivals other natural fibers like bamboo and silk.

In terms of durability, lyocell fabrics are surprisingly resilient, resistant to wrinkles and shrinking even after repeated washing cycles. This means less time spent ironing and more time enjoying your eco-friendly clothing.

Frequently Asked Questions

Is eco-friendly lyocell suitable for high-temperature environments?

Eco-friendly lyocell has a moderate heat resistance, which means it can handle temperatures up to around 120°C (248°F) without significant degradation. However, prolonged exposure to high temperatures may cause the fibers to break down. If you’re planning to use lyocell in applications where extreme heat is present, consider adding heat-resistant treatments or using blends with other materials.

Can I dye eco-friendly lyocell to create custom colors?

Yes, eco-friendly lyocell can be dyed using eco-friendly dyes and processes. This allows for a wide range of color options while maintaining the sustainable benefits of lyocell. However, it’s essential to follow specific guidelines and use environmentally responsible dyeing methods to avoid compromising the material’s eco-friendliness.

How does eco-friendly lyocell compare to other biodegradable fabrics in terms of durability?

Eco-friendly lyocell is known for its exceptional durability and resistance to wrinkles, making it a strong competitor among biodegradable fabrics. However, its lifespan can vary depending on factors like usage, maintenance, and quality of production. When compared to other sustainable materials, lyocell often holds up well, but proper care and handling are crucial to maximize its longevity.

Can I use eco-friendly lyocell for upholstery or other home decor applications?

Yes, eco-friendly lyocell is an excellent choice for upholstery and other home decor projects due to its softness, breathability, and resistance to pilling. Its natural fiber composition also allows it to conform well to various shapes, making it suitable for creating unique textures and patterns.

Are there any certifications or labels I should look for when sourcing eco-friendly lyocell products?

When searching for authentic eco-friendly lyocell products, look for certifications like Oeko-Tex Standard 100, Bluesign, or GOTS (Global Organic Textile Standard). These labels ensure that the product meets rigorous environmental and social standards. Additionally, check if the manufacturer adheres to sustainable production methods and uses responsible supply chains to further verify its eco-friendliness.
